    So stopped at La Madeleine for some breakfast and got the Quiche Lorraine. They changed the ham that was in it to little ham squares and raised the price. I don't mind if you raise the price but don't skimp on the ham. It makes the whole quiche taste different and not in the best way. It's like Little Rocks within the quiche. A lot of La Madeleine's food is like heat and serve and it's been that way since they turned the chain into more of a "fast-food" establishment rather than a cook-to-order restaurant. Best to get something that has to be prepared. Or a pastry

    Overall, I think la Madeleine is a restaurant you can skip if you're scoping out a new restaurant to try. I have eaten there several times but only because my mother's workplace gives out gift cards here as prizes. If my family didn't have gift cards here, we wouldn't eat here. I'll start with the food. Pictured below is what we ate on this most recent trip. The French onion soup was alright, but I personally thought it was much too salty. The chicken riviera sandwich was passable but quite bland. The pesto pasta with roasted shrimp was, again, passable but also quite bland. The sea salt baguette was good and was the best part of the meal. We took a fruit tart to-go, and that was good. In the past, I have tried the chocolate tart, lemon tart, and the sacher torte parfait, all of which were sweet and pleasant. Next, the service. The employees were pleasant, but the way the restaurant is set up is confusing. You order before seating yourself. It wasn't really clear, and it's also confusing if/when you tip. I don't think you're missing out if you don't eat here. I think the best things they have to offer are the pastries/bakery items at the front.

    1. Came to the bakery and asked if the butter croissants contained eggs. The woman working replied, "No I don't think so" and I said is there anyone that knows for certain or has a list of ingredients because we have an egg allergy. I was told No, and that there was nobody that knew the ingredients since the croissants came frozen. I asked her to check the box list of ingredients, only to find out that they do actually contain eggs. Had I not been persistent, we could have had an allergic reaction in the restaurant. The person with egg allergy was not able to eat ANYTHING HERE because there is nothing being done for allergy safety/sanitization to avoid cross contamination either. AVOID THIS PLACE IF YOU HAVE ALLERGIES. 2. The "nutella croissant" had no Nutella inside, so it's basically the same as the butter croissant - frozen as well. 3.
